Thanks for your comment, Katie! It is exciting, isn’t it?! 🙂 I had asked Rob from Montessori Compass about downloading or printing the Scope & Sequence. This was his response: “The S&S is available to be viewed in its entirety online for free. It is easily searchable by key words (click the magnifying glass icon) and each section has a table of contents (horizontal lines icon) to help navigate. Due to the enormous amount of time and effort involved in developing this resource, it is not presently available to be downloaded or printed. Montessori Compass subscribers receive this as the default curriculum in their account. Subscribers can then customize, add new lessons, and adapt it any way they see fit to meet the needs of their school.”
